Making Economic Advancement Mean Ecological Improvement

Hangzhou Declaration


From 18th to 19th May 2013, about 500 politicians, natural scientists, social scientists and eminent persons from 23 countries, gathered in Hangzhou City, a famous historical and cultural city in China, to attend the Second Annual Conference of World Cultural Forum (Taihu, China); participants freely shared their perspectives and discussed important issues concerning the enhancement of international cooperation and the construction of ecological civilization, contributors hereby it is hereby declare their consensus as follow:

 

(I) Since the 1972 Declaration of the United Nations Stockholm Conference on the Human Environment, the international community has made significant efforts to addresse the cological crisis. However, the contradiction between development and environment is still remain. Scientific observations and international difficulties reveal that global environmental pollution, ecological damage and resource shortages have not been fundamentally alleviated, instead, they have become worse, with serious threats to the survival and development of humankind. This situation caused great attentions from the people of all countries.

 

(II) The world today is undergoing significant changes and adjustments, but a wide North-South gap remains. Developed countries' economic strength far exceeds that of most developing countries. The people of all countries have the right to live peaceful and prosperous lives. Fully respecting the developing countries’s right to develop conforms to common wish of the people of all countries, which is also an important basis to alleviate the tensions between development and environment. Ecological crisis, which is emerging during development, should be addressed correctly. It is not an issue of denying the development, but an issue of following what modes of development. The fundamental way to solve ecological crisis depends on the innovation path and mode of development .

 

 

 

(III) The global ecological emerges from the defects of traditional industrialization. Industrial revolution contributed a new chapter in human civilization. Industrialization has become the basic path to economic prosperity in modern countries. However, traditional industrialization rely on the great consumption of resources and wasteful emissions; human beings conquer and plunder nature, such approaches have become incorporated into indutrial of consumption and life. Driven by the persuit of capitalist profitablity, humans utilizes the nature in an uncontrolled manner, so as to stimulate and satisfy people’s unlimited material desires, this results in continual destruction in the harmony between human and nature and the harmony between human and society, which is the deep origin of the occurrence of ecological crisis. We should reconsider the relationship between human and nature since industrial revolutions, we need a new vision of ecological civilization, and the harmony between human and nature and the harmony between human and society should be reconstructed.

 

(IV) Ecological civilization is a new civilization form that is beyond industrial civilization. Its core concept is to respect, comply with and preserve the nature, it is based on the carrying capacity of the resources and the environment, takes natural laws as guiding principles and regards sustainable development as the aim; it fundamentally changes the traditional mode of production and way of life featuring excessive consumption of natural resources and excessive waste emissions; it develops green economy, circular economy and low carbon economy, constructs a resource-saving and environment-friendly society, promotes the harmonious coexistence of human and nature and the harmonious development of human and society. It is not only the highest priority in responding to global ecological crisis, but also the long-term plan for the progress of human civilization.

 

(V) The construction of ecological civilization emphass integration. The construction of ecological civilization is not only a serious issue facing developing countries, but also a major common challenge facing mankind, thus it is necessary for all countries to work in partnership; it should not only be limited to local scientific and technological problems of a professional and technical nature, it should also be cultural issues that have a bearing on overall  significance and a profound social and strategic nature, thus it needs the joint breakthroughs in the fields of science and humanities; it does not only directly relates to the sustainable development of economy and refers to the fundamental transformation of the modes of production and consumption, but also relates to various aspects of political, cultural and social constructions and refers to the fundamental changes of people’s life style, intercourse mode and mode of thinking, thus it needs an extensive participation of the country, society, enterprises, especially the public.

 

(VI) The construction of ecological civilization is a complex issue. All countries should proceed from their realities, such as population, resources, environment, historical and cultural traditions, social system and the level of economic development, and draw lessons from experiences of other countries, so as to explore the way and pattern for the construction of ecological civilization suitable to their national conditions, and they should act independently but achieve the same goal by different means. The concept of an integral whole with a common destiny should be established among human beings, and all countries should execute their assigned tasks through close cooperation. Developing countries should actively explore a new road to industrialization that can realize green development, circular development and low carbon development, and they should complete industrialization during the construction of ecological civilization. Developed countries should bring their superiorities in technology and economy into full play, so as to help developing countries to reduce emissions and control pollution, and they should also have the courage to bear the historical responsibility of environmental pollution, get rid of the historical inertia of traditional industrial civilization and construct a new ecological civilization. The principle of common but differentiated responsibilities, the principles of equity and the principles of respective capabilities should be adhered to, so as to put an end to buck-passing, beggar-thy-neighbor and disaster-transferring, and pursue the win-win cooperation on addressing the ecological crisis and constructing ecological civilization.

 

(VII) The construction of ecological civilization is system project. It should be explored arduously in a long term and constructed systematically. Since the development of human civilization, our understandings on the development and changes of nature and the short-term and long-term effects caused by human activities on nature are fairly superficial, and some areas still remain uncovered.  The exchanges and cooperation among different civilizations should be enhanced; and different nations’ ecological wisdoms and experiences of  should be respected and motivated throughout the world, so as to learn from one another, overcome difficulties and promote the construction of ecological civilization continuously. We should conform to the trend of the times, draw lessons from history, discard the Cold-War mentality, and safeguard the long-term construction of ecological civilization by peace.

(VIII) To address with the ecological crisis and construct ecological civilization, we must rely firmly on the people and make the work become the people's great spontaneous practices. The construction of ecological civilization relates to fundamental and all-round social changes; and it will result in great social changes that transform the prevailing habits and customs, thus the people's right to know, their right of supervision and their right of participation  must be guaranteed, and the public accomplishment of ecological civilization must be improved continuously. Everyone is responsible to deal with ecological crisis and begins with oneself, continuous victories will be achieved in the construction of ecological civilization, and human beings will enter a new era of ecological civilization.
